The Importance of Regular Chimney Inspections in Ohio
Even if your fireplace sees light use, Ohio's freeze-thaw cycles, heavy snowfall, and humid summers can swiftly damage masonry, flue liners, and caps. Regular chimney inspections are necessary to evaluate structural stability, proper clearances, and venting standards per NFPA 211 and local code. A certified technician will document creosote levels, check for moisture damage, assess crown and flashing, and confirm that termination devices and dampers operate correctly. They'll also inspect ventilation pathways and monitor carbon monoxide risk.
Professional evaluations help maintain periodic maintenance by spotting developing issues including hairline mortar cracks, spalling masonry, and metal deterioration before serious issues arise. You can decrease fire risks, improve chimney efficiency, and prolong equipment lifespan. Make sure to include wildlife prevention by confirming securely installed covers and mesh sized to prevent wildlife and pests from creating habitats while ensuring proper draft.
Warning Signs Your Chimney or Fireplace Requires Urgent Service
Regular inspections identify problems early, but you should watch for warning signs that require immediate service to meet requirements of NFPA 211 and Ohio building codes. Should you observe lingering smoke smell, inadequate airflow, or black residue, you could have a flue blockage or excessive creosote buildup that increases fire risk. Set up CO alarms and consider all CO alarms emergency situations. Look for water stains on ceilings or near the firebox, which suggest a compromised cap. Be aware of wildlife and buildup. Examine for chimney lean, cracked masonry, or structural damage requiring immediate assessment. Hard-to-light or poorly burning fires indicate airflow problems. Any smoke spillage, falling embers, or loose fragments needs a CSIA-certified inspection right away.
Best Practices for Annual Cleaning and Creosote Removal
To maintain safety and performance, book a CSIA-certified inspection and cleaning at least once during each heating season - or increase frequency with heavy usage or detect Stage 2-3 creosote. This adheres to NFPA 211 recommendations and minimizes creosote buildup. Schedule during non-peak seasons to ensure timely service. A certified professional will inspect flue condition, ventilation effectiveness, safety distances, and pipe conditions, then thoroughly clean soot and creosote deposits using appropriate cleaning equipment and HEPA filtration systems.
You can assist between burning sessions by following these guidelines: burn only seasoned hardwood (containing less than 20% moisture), maintain proper air supply to avoid smoldering, and ensure flue temperatures steady. Install a thermometer on stoves and make sure smoke path components are secure. After consuming each cord, check for 1/8 inch deposits; when reaching 1/4 inch, stop using the appliance until properly cleaned.
Expert Services: Masonry Work, Crown & Cap Repairs, Waterproofing Solutions
After ensuring creosote levels are controlled, it's crucial to keep the structural stability and weather resistance of your chimney. Ohio's freeze-thaw cycles can damage masonry joints and brickwork, so plan masonry maintenance using ASTM-compliant masonry materials and matching tooling techniques for existing joints. Rebuild damaged crowns using a strengthened, fiber-reinforced cement mixture, correctly sloped and featuring an extended water barrier for water deflection. Install or replace stainless-steel caps with rust-resistant fasteners and correctly fitted spark arrestors sized to the flue opening.
Make flashing repair at roof intersections a top priority, properly installing step and counter-flashing within mortar joints. Seal all laps and maintain proper clearance from combustible materials according to NFPA 211 standards. Treat exterior masonry with vapor-permeable waterproofing and don't use film-forming sealers that can trap moisture. Document thoroughly all repairs, drying times, and warranties, and establish regular seasonal inspections to monitor effectiveness.

Material Options for Liners
When choosing the proper chimney liner material involves pairing it with your appliance, fuel type, and local code requirements. Stainless steel options provide durability and are UL-listed for gas, oil, and wood applications. Consider choosing rigid stainless for straight flues or flexible stainless for offsets; choose 316 alloy for oil/wood applications and 304 for gas if code permits. Always insulate as required for maintaining appropriate clearances and optimal flue temperatures.
Ceramic options consist of clay tile alongside cast-in-place installations. Clay offers an affordable solution for new masonry construction but requires appropriate sizing and intact joints. Cast-in-place liners strengthen older stacks and provide an uninterrupted, heat-resistant flue.
Consider corrosion class, thermal shock resistance, and diameter specifications as per NFPA 211 and manufacturer requirements. Make sure to check connector compatibility, end components, and Ohio building code compliance before installing.
Security and Performance
While liner selection begins with dimensional requirements and materials, performance and safety rely on how effectively the liner handles heat, draft, and combustion byproducts according to building codes. You need a continuous, properly sized flue path to ensure stable airflow, optimize fireplace ventilation, and avoid cooling of exhaust gases that results in acid or creosote buildup. Effective insulation keeps chimney temperature, improving combustion efficiency and minimizing ignition risks. Durable liners control carbon monoxide and water vapor, protecting the masonry and nearby combustible materials.
Align the liner diameter based on the appliance outlet as specified by NFPA 211 and manufacturer listings; using too large a diameter weakens draft, using too small a diameter elevates stack temperature and fume leakage. Verify clearances and joints are gas-tight. Install carbon monoxide detectors on each floor and near sleeping areas. Book annual Level II assessments and record performance measurements: CO levels, draft measurements, and temperature readings.

Top-Sealing Damper Benefits
A top-sealing damper, often overlooked, provides essential protection by sealing the flue at the chimney crown. This crucial element eliminates conditioned air loss, stops downward air movement, and prevents water damage and pest entry. By creating a seal at the top, it helps decrease the column of cold air in the flue, enhancing energy conservation and decreasing stack-effect heat loss during Ohio's cold season. Furthermore, you'll protect your flue from weather-related deterioration, which limits frost-related deterioration and wear.
Installed using stainless hardware and a high-temperature gasket, working via a firebox-mounted cable. It's required to open it completely before starting any fire to maintain proper combustion and safe venting in accordance with NFPA 211. We carefully measure and anchor the frame to align with your flue tile, verify lid travel and seal compression, and verify smoke-tight closure for regulation-compliant performance.

Choosing an Expert Ohio Chimney Professional
When selecting a professional to maintain, clean, or service your chimney in Ohio, be certain to confirm they hold proper, acknowledged qualifications and comply with state and local code requirements. Request CSIA or NFI certification and documentation of ongoing education. Request written details, photo documentation, and code references for all Certified inspections. Verify they follow NFPA 211, IRC/IMC, and manufacturer listings for system components, distances, and outlets.
Conduct licensing validation via the Ohio Construction Industry Licensing Board where required, and verify the contractor carries Ohio-accepted insurance coverage for liability and workers' compensation. Ask for current local licensing and completed inspection forms. Check their BBB standing, certification in gas appliances, and CO testing capabilities. Require detailed estimates, warranty documentation, and a detailed remediation plan for Level 2 findings upon completion of appliance replacement or chimney relining.

What Are Typical Costs for Chimney and Fireplace Services in Ohio?
The typical cost ranges from $100-$250 for a Level 1 sweep, $200-$400 for chimney inspections, and $300-$1,200 for essential masonry repairs. Full relining costs $1,500-$4,000; tuckpointing services range from $8-$20 per linear foot. Construction and rebuild costs fluctuate based on codes and materials. Emergency service calls include $100-$300 for non-standard hours. Ask for detailed written specifications including NFPA 211 standards and proof of insurance. Verify Level 2/3 inspections before property transfer or fire damage.

How Much Time Should I Allow for a Chimney Service Call?
Set aside an hour to hour and a half session. This timeframe covers setup, access, and a complete NFPA 211-compliant inspection. You will get a detailed Level I visual evaluation, including draft and clearance checks, and a comprehensive technical report verifying your flue system, cap, crown, firebox, and smoke chamber components. Should sweeping be needed, plan for an additional 30-60 minutes with professional HEPA vacuum equipment. Level II camera inspections or masonry repairs will require additional time. Make sure your pets are contained and the firebox hasn't been used for 12 hours prior.
